Airport express wont connect anything but my macbook pro

Hello!
I've searched but cannot find an answer to this question so here goes:
Today I purchased an AirPort Express and was able to configure my MacBook Pro to connect to it problem free.  I've created the network using airport utility but none of the other devices in my household can connect to the network: iPhone 4s, iPhone 5, AppleTV, & iPad Mini.  They all discover the device but none will connect.
Help me please!!!!
Thanks!!!!

Very simple solution: I was in Bridge Mode and switched it over to DHCP and NAT.  Boom....problem solved.

  • Airport express wont connect to internet

    i cant get my airport express to connect to the internet

    I would recommend that you do the following as a minimum:
    Power-down the modem, AirPort base station, and computer(s).
    Power-up the modem; wait at least 10-15 minutes to allow it adequate time to initialize.
    Power-up the AirPort base station; wait at least 5-10 minutes. Note: The AirPort's status light may continue to flash amber after it has intialized. That is because, there may be some additional configuration items necessary, like setting up wireless security, before the overall setup is completed to get a green status.
    Power-up your computer(s).
    If the above steps do not solve the problem, start over with step 1 above, but then perform the next steps between steps 1 & 2. above.
    Disconnect the AirPort base station from the Internet broadband modem.
    While all of the devices are powered-down, perform a "factory default" reset on the base station. This will get it back to its "out-of-the-box" configuration and make setting it up much easier, especially if you use the "Assist me" process within the AirPort Utility. (ref: Resetting an AirPort Base Station or Time Capsule)
    After the base station resets, go ahead and power it back down.
    Reconnect the AirPort base station to the Internet broadband modem. For the Extreme and Time Capsule, be sure to connect the cable to the base station's WAN (circle-of-dots) port.
    Continue with step 2 in the first set of steps.
    In this basic configuration, the AirPort base station will broadcast an unsecured wireless network with a Network Name (SSID) of Apple Network NNNNNN. Network clients, connected to the base station either by wire or wireless, should now be able to access the Internet through the ISP's modem. Once Internet connectivity has been verified, you can use the AirPort Utility to configure the base station for wireless security and any other desired options. Please post back your results.

  • Signal strength from Airport Express dropping to imac (but not Macbook)

    I have an Airport Extreme to control my home wireless network. My Macbook Pro works all over the house with no reception/signal strength problems. But my imac, which is situated about 15/18metres away is dropping signal all the time. Any ideas or advice please?
    Cheers
    Simon

    The antenna opening for the iMac is on the back of the screen, so make sure that the iMac is not pushed back into a cabinet or even a corner of the room. Sometimes a small change in location will make a big difference in reception.
    Also check to make sure that you do not have other electronics near the iMac like a cordless phone, ampliifer, satellite receiver, TV, etc.
    If the iMac is near a window, it may be picking up wireless interference from another network in the neighborhood near you. Try to move the iMac away from the window to a different location.
    Power off the iMac and restart after any change in location so that it will establish a new connection.
    If you try everthing and the results seem to be the same, then you might want to think about taking the iMac to an Apple store in your area to let them have a look and check out the wireless card in the device.

  • I have bought a new airport express and using it with my macbook (iTunes 10.2.2). I have joined an existing network for internet in my home and with that i am trying to play the music via itunes but there is audio dropouts every 60 secs or so. any soln ?

    I have bought a new airport express and using it with my macbook (iTunes 10.2.2). I have joined an existing wireless network for internet in my home and with that i am trying to play the music via itunes but there is audio dropouts every 60 secs or so. I am using a set of speakers from kenwood connected to the airport express. The operating system on my macbook is mac os X 10.5.8. i am sure it is not a problem of streaming music online because i have even tried playing music which are stored in my macbook.
    Is there any problem with the setting in itunes or quicktime ? Kindly reply...... I am waiting for your valuable suggestion.
    Thank you a lot in advance.

    I am shocked to have found this same AX audio dropout problem starting TODAY, every few seconds the audio just drops for a couple seconds and then resumes:  Latest software versions of everything.  No iPad, iPhone or Touch.  Internet hardwired to D-Link DES1105 (1000baseT Switch) hardwired to new 80211N AX, AX optical to stereo, AX Wi-Fi internet to basic 1st-gen MacBook operating at 80211G, and an older 'G' AX extender at the far end of the house, away from all this.  The MacBook streaming iTunes is usually 12 feet from AX.  I've used this setup for years of trouble-free AirTunes / Airplay until today.  Today I also found 2 very reliable fixes and 1 way to force a dropout, but first, I read some posts and tried ALL following settings one-at-a-time and restored them ALL because NONE of them helped:  Turned off IPV6.  Streamed to multiple speakers 'Computer' and 'AX' (restored to just AX).  Turned off 'Ask to Join new (WiFi) Networks'.  Turned off Bluetooth (can't live without Magic Trackpad, so glad that wasn't it).  Here's my discoveries:  Lo and behold, each time I click the Airport icon in the Menu (you know it shows you've got 4 bars from AX) when the status switches to 'Looking for Networks' for a second it CAUSES the AX audio to drop out for a couple seconds (it never did that before today.)  iTunes still playing, streaming, AX laser still lit, but the 'PCM' light on stereo and the sound GOES OUT EVERY time I click the Airport icon in the menubar, just like the regular, annoying dropouts.  So, to reduce traffic I quit Safari (3 tabs, no streaming, just Gmail, Google, and Netflix browsing).  Lo and behold, the dropouts stopped altogether.  No other Web apps going (not iTunes Store, Genius, Ping, nothing), so I launched Chrome to the same 3 tabs and the dropouts HAVE NOT RETURNED.  That's right, not only did simply QUITTING SAFARI cure it, and Chrome doesn't contribute to it, but I can demonstrate it just by forcing my Airport to re-scan.  Works for me, written using Chrome.  The other reliable fix is to hardwire MacBook to the Switch.  This is obviously not ideal, but Airplay audio doesn't drop out over Ethernet.  Also, in all my tests, it made no difference whether iTunes did the streaming, or Airfoil did.
